Insee, the Institut National de la Statistique et des Études Économiques, is France's national institute for statistics and economic studies. It is responsible for collecting, analyzing, and disseminating statistical information about the French economy and society. Insee's data is used by policymakers, businesses, and researchers to understand economic trends, make informed decisions, and evaluate public policies.
